You can get a mobility scooter if you are having difficulty getting around. You can choose from a range of sizes and speeds, based on the way you intend to use it.
Some insurance policies provide coverage for the cost of mobility scooters, like Medicare and Medicaid. People who receive social security payments may also be eligible for these coverages.

Medicare covers mobility scooters as durable medical devices however, you must have a doctor's recommendation and prescription. Medicaid coverage varies from state to state. You can dial the Medicare card number to learn more about your coverage options.
You may need to purchase a vehicle lift or ramp in order to transport your scooter in a vehicle or van, truck, or SUV. The weight of the most heavy product is usually listed on the spec sheet, so you can compare it to the load capacity of your vehicle. A lot of mobility scooters for travel are designed to be broken into smaller pieces and folded in order to make them easier for you to transport in your vehicle. These models are lighter and less expensive than other scooters. Some models come with a carry bag for convenience. Some feature LED lights on the deck and front to ensure safety, as well an electric horn.

Although there are a variety of scooter models available on the market, they all function in the same way. Scooters are made up of four basic components: a steering tiller (or handle) and battery, a motor, and wheels. The steering tiller is used to determine the direction of travel, and the motor and wheels are used to move forwards and backwards. The battery provides the power to propel the scooter, and some batteries also come with a light to help you see.
As compared to wheelchairs, scooters are usually cheaper and offer more flexible features. They are also much easier to navigate over uneven pavements than power wheelchairs and are able to be operated in areas wheelchairs can't. They are also considered less stigmatizing for people who are able-bodied and many people find them more comfortable to use over long distances.
Depending on the state, scooters may be used on sidewalks and other pedestrian areas with the appropriate safety equipment. It is important to be aware of your surroundings and not hinder pedestrian traffic. In addition it is recommended that you wear a helmet and reflective materials to ensure your safety. Additionally, you should never operate your scooter on a road unless it is specifically permitted.

Depending on the location you live in, there may be different laws regarding the use of mobility scooters. For instance, in North Dakota, scooters are classified as personal assistive electric mobility devices, which means that they are not considered vehicles and therefore do not need to be registered or insured. However, you must follow all traffic laws if you are operating an electric scooter in public areas. You must obey all traffic signals, and use crosswalks when they are available. Also, you must adhere to the speed limit within a reasonable range in order to ensure the safety and security of pedestrians and other scooter users.

There are many financing options to make a Mobility scooter usa scooter more affordable. These financing options are available through third-party lenders as well as medical equipment retailers and even dealerships. It is important to understand the various financing options and how they operate before applying. You will then be able to determine the most suitable financing option for you.
One of the most popular financing options for mobility scooters is through non-profit organizations. These organizations offer low-interest loans that can make the purchase more affordable to individuals with budgets that are tight. A personal loan can be obtained through banks or credit unions. These loans may require a credit check however, they usually have lower interest rates than mobility scooter financing.
